This quiz assesses student mastery of geochronology, specifically focusing on relative and absolute dating techniques within the fossil record. The assessment utilizes a scaffolded approach by moving from fundamental stratigraphic principles to complex isotopic analysis and paleoenvironmental interpretations. It is an ideal summative tool for Earth Science or Paleontology units, aligning with high school standards for evaluating evidence of deep time and biological evolution.

- Differentiate between relative dating principles like the Law of Superposition and absolute dating methods using radioisotopes.
- Identify the characteristics of index fossils and the environmental conditions required for exceptional preservation in the fossil record.
- Analyze the significance of unconformities and cross-cutting relationships in determining the chronological history of geological strata.
